Last August, we told you that Ridley Scott would direct a sequel to his classic 1982 sci-fi film Blade Runner. Today, we have news about the sequel’s screenwriter!

It was revealed today that Hampton Fancher, who co-wrote Blade Runner, is in talks to pen the sequel produced by Alcon Entertainment.

We already stated in August that Harrison Ford will not be returning, and today we learned some more news:

Alcon is acknowledging the film is a sequel, and that it takes place some years after the first film concluded.
